**Action item (owner: routing team):** Following the Skylark incident where malformed deep links looped users into the onboarding flow, we are tightening the mobile router's resolution budget. The fix adds a bounded redirect chain, a parse timeout, and a fallback threshold before handing off to web. These values were validated against the captured incident traffic. The agreed constants are listed below.

constants for tageg-kagag:
QUOTAS = {
    "kelax": 495,
    "istath": 366,
    "tammir": 108,
    "novdor": 730,
    "casax": 816,
    "quenael": 874,
    "pelius": 403,
}

**Timeline — Mailhopper bounce processor incident**

14:02 — Bounce queue depth began climbing after the Fernwick upgrade rolled out. 14:11 — On-call noticed retries looping on malformed DSN payloads. 14:25 — Priya paused the consumer and drained the poison messages to a side queue. 14:48 — Patched parser deployed; queue recovered by 15:10. No customer mail was lost, though suppression-list updates lagged by roughly an hour. The exact artifact that shipped the fix is recorded below.

session token of kageg-tahop = htk14_af3c1ccccb7dcf

Re: timestamp validation in the Brackwell build pipeline — I traced the flaky cache invalidations to clock skew between our Osprey and Kestrel agent pools. Some agents drift up to 400ms before NTP corrects them, which is enough to make artifact freshness checks misfire. Rather than trusting raw wall-clock comparisons, I've added a tolerance window plus a monotonic fallback when skew exceeds the threshold. For the weekly sync: please review whether these margins are conservative enough. The current tuning constants are as follows.

tuning constants:
QUOTAS = {
    "quenael": 10,
    "oliwyn": 1,
}